Definition
An informal and sometimes rude way to strongly emphasize a question about a person's identity, showing surprise, anger, or disbelief.
IPA Transcription
American English
ˈhu/ /ˈðə/, /ðə/, /ði/ /ˈhɛɫ
British English
hˈuː/ /ðə, ði/ /hˈɛl
Simplified Pronunciation
US
HOO-thuh-HEL
UK
HOO-thuh-HEL
